What is a Casino Online?

A casino online is a gambling website where people can play a variety of games for real money. This includes online slots, video poker, baccarat, roulette, blackjack, and more. Players can also place bets on live dealer games, which are hosted via a webcam and managed by a professional dealer.

The casino online business model involves many components, including the design of a user-friendly site and a mobile app, an extensive game library, and secure payment options. A reliable casino online should offer a wide range of payment methods, including credit/debit cards, e-wallets, and bank transfers. It should also have low or no transaction fees and a convenient withdrawal process. In addition, the site should be licensed and regulated by a reputable gaming control board in your state.
